Transaction ec76381ee16428cb3771ffa66f312eb488353085604d403db0be7dbe09773c99
1 Input
1 Output
-
ec76381ee16428cb3771ffa66f312eb488353085604d403db0be7dbe09773c99: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3bdcf70a8e9a8b67c22f9316be9370228c8f00f6f290165c98855ac0cd013f3a
- address
- bc1p80w0wz5wn29k0s30jvttaymsy2xg7q8k72gpvhycs4dvpngp8uaqyf7ny6